Official Description (provided by the hotel):
Pieve di Caminino is a former XIth century monastery in the countryside of south Tuscany, owned and managed since 1872 by a family of Florentine architects. Authentic boutique hospitality in seven charming suites, sharing a 500 hectares 1.500 acres)fenced panoramic private property, with centenary olive grove, vineyard, cork tree forest, park with ponds and pool facing the suggestive Montemassi castle. Pieve di Caminino is not - and does not want to be - a luxury hotel: in order to respect all the authentic atmosphere of an original countryside XIth century property , our suites do not have TVs and telephones, because our guests prefer sipping wine in front of a gleaming fireplace or watching a stunning Tuscan sunset disappear into the Caminino olive groves, enjoying all of nature's bounty and beauty. (Wi-Fi free internet is however available). ... more   less
